Whitson leaves as Cougars’ softball coach

Whitson leaves as Cougars’ softball coach

Chad Whitson coached Southwestern Randolph’s softball team to strong seasons. (Randolph Record file photo) ASHEBORO – Southwestern Randolph softball coach Chad Whitson has resigned after five seasons, the school announced Monday. The Cougars held a 65-22 record under Whitson’s direction. Toby Strider, who had been an assistant coach, has been promoted to head coach. Strider also previously coached at the middle school. The Cougars positioned a 22-2 record this year, going undefeated in Piedmont Athletic Conference play and ranking among the top teams in the state in Class 2-A. Softball teams ousted in fourth round

Softball teams ousted in fourth round

Jayla Ferguson scores for Uwharrie Charter Academy in a softball victory against North Stokes in the third round of the Class 1-A state playoffs. (Scott Pelkey/Randolph Record)   All in one night, the dreams of state championships for three Randolph County softball teams were dashed. They all had reached West Regional semifinals, but then Southwestern Randolph, Eastern Randolph and Uwharrie Charter Academy went down Friday night. Class 2-A At Asheboro, West Wilkes knocked off host Southwestern Randolph 2-1 in 10 innings. Leah Greene’s sacrifice fly in the 10th inning for third-seeded West Wilkes was the difference. Cruising Cougars collect PAC Tournament title in softball

Cruising Cougars collect PAC Tournament title in softball

Southwestern Randolph team members celebrate after the PAC Tournament championship game against visiting Providence Grove. (Scott Pelkey/Randolph Record) ASHEBORO – Macie Crutchfield threw a three-hit shutout with 11 strikeouts as Southwestern Randolph completed its domination of the Piedmont Athletic Conference with Thursday night’s 7-0 victory against visiting Providence Grove in the league tournament championship game. Carleigh Whitson had two hits and two runs batted in to help the Cougars to their first conference tournament title in eight years.
